Just wanted to let everyone know how good the customer service is at Xcite Powersports in Pleasant Grove, Utah. I Recently bought two machines from the owner Dave Parduhn. A 500 cc Trakker 4 x 4 Buggy Truck and a Trakker 250 cc machine for the kids.

When I was in the research phase Dave answered all of my questions and was really someone I liked dealing with. After several return trips to narrow down which models I was interested in Dave and his son closed the shop and took me and my boys out to a place called five mile pass for test rides. This wasn't just unload the buggies drive them around for 2-3 minutes and go back to do the paper work.

Dave and his son let me and the boys get a good feel for the machines.

Due to work issues and being away from home I didn't even make a decision until almost seven months later. Dave didn't make repeated phone calls pressuring me to buy. We puchased in mid November of this year. (Both machines)

I did have some issues with the 250 early on, however Dave took prompt action and fixed everything under warranty.

This guy has gone out of his way to make things right. I had a lower ball joint on the 500 machine fail about six weeks ago. When I asked Dave about a part or somewhere I could take it, he felt really bad about all the trouble we were having. Believe it or not Dave actually gave me a second 500 for NOTHING!!!. I have the bill of sale.

The 500cc machine went for about $5200.00. Dave's shop also carries those Japanese mini trucks. He now specializes in that line.
